  • What is Joon?

    Joon is an app that uses games and gamification to help families manage chores and tasks in a fun way. With an emphasis on child development, Joon transforms mundane tasks into exciting quests where children can earn coins and rewards for their completion, thereby enhancing their motivation and accountability, while promoting self-control and positive habits.

    Joon uses strategies that encourage teamwork and cooperation, adding enjoyable aspects to everyday routines and fostering better peer interaction. It provides visual tools and feedback to monitor progress, making it a helpful tool for parents who want to develop good habits in their children, with resources from child psychologists.     What Features Does Joon Offer for Chores Management?

    Joon includes many tools to make organizing chores easier, providing a range of resources to support families. Using a fun game-like method, it helps children stay interested and responsible for their tasks, developing important life skills like teamwork and collaboration. These features include specific tools for progress tracking, skill development, and engagement:

    • Task assignment with adjustable difficulty levels, promoting self-control and responsibility
    • Progress tracking to visualize accomplishments, boosting their focus and motivation
    • A rewards system where children can earn coins for completed chores, encouraging kindness and positive behavior

    Notifications are included, sending timely alerts that help families stay organized and involved in finishing chores, while promoting better peer interaction.

    One of the standout features is its customizable task assignments, which allow parents to set chores that perfectly match their child’s capabilities, ensuring a sense of achievement is always within reach, and aligning with their strengths and weaknesses.

    The progress tracking tool shows what has been done, helping children feel proud when they see their efforts turn into real outcomes and fostering a sense of stamina and knowledge.

    The rewards system incentivizes participation, transforming mundane chores into exciting challenges where kids can compete against their own records or earn rewards that can be spent on fun activities, while building their strengths.

    These elements encourage responsibility and teamwork, while helping develop important life skills in a fun way, enhancing their educational experience.

    Step 1: Download and Install the Joon App

    To begin using Joon, the first step is to download and install the app from your preferred mobile platform, making it accessible for the entire family to engage in chore management and improve productivity. Once downloaded, users can easily move through the app’s interface, which is simple and easy to use, making task management efficient. This makes sure that both parents and children can use the features without any problems.

    The installation process varies slightly depending on whether you’re using an Android or iOS device.

    1. For Android users, simply visit the Google Play Store, search for Joon, and tap ‘Install’.
    2. iOS users can access the App Store, locate Joon, and follow the same procedure.

    After installation, open the app to begin the setup and start involving the family in new game dynamics. Users will be prompted to create an account, which involves entering essential information like email and a password.

    Step 4: Create a List of Chores

    Making a list of chores in Joon is important for turning responsibilities into a game. It helps organize and share tasks among family members. By categorizing chores based on difficulty and type, parents can effectively assign age-appropriate tasks to children, fostering skills like self-control and accountability while keeping them engaged through a fun activity and enhancing their learning experience.

    This structured method clearly sets expectations and helps children take responsibility for their tasks, while also improving their strengths and addressing any weaknesses.

    For instance, younger children might engage in simpler chores such as sorting laundry or watering plants, which builds foundational skills and confidence, and helps in their overall child development. As they grow, tasks can evolve into more complex jobs like meal preparation or organizing their study areas, improving their skills and self-control.

    By gradually increasing the challenge, children remain motivated and their interest in completing chores sustains, reinforcing their focus and stamina.

    Utilizing Joon’s categorization feature allows families to review progress and celebrate achievements, making the entire experience rewarding and enjoyable, and helping to build positive habits.
